The Karkonosze Range form as part of the Sudetes, the natural border between Silesia and Bohemia. A character of the UNESCO Biosphere Reserve are mystical rock formations that are often reminiscent of mythical animals and beings. On the plateaus are found bizarre rocks, glacial lakes and rare plant and animal species. The hospitality of the people in the mountain villages is legendary, even if here the mountain spirit “Rubezahl” enables both locals and visitors into fear… The wooden church “Wang” is the most popular photo motif of the Karkonosze Range and located in the tourist destination Karpacz at the foot of the Mt Śnieżka.
